linux进入权限的命令

fiy 其他 45

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ux进入权限的命令是”chmod”(change mode)命令。该命令用于改变文件或目录的权限。

    使用”chmod”命令需要指定两个参数:权限模式和文件或目录的名称。权限模式可以使用数字表示法(例如777)或符号表示法(例如u+rwx)。

    在命令行中,使用”chmod”命令的一般语法如下:

    chmod [选项] 权限模式 文件或目录名称

    以下是一些常用的权限模式:
    – r:读取权限,表示可以查看文件或目录的内容;
    – w:写入权限,表示可以修改文件或目录;
    – x:执行权限,表示可以运行可执行文件或进入目录。

    可以使用如下符号表示法设置权限:
    – u:表示用户(owner)权限;
    – g:表示组(group)权限;
    – o:表示其他用户(others)权限;
    – a:表示所有权限。

    例如,以下命令将文件test.txt的所有者权限设置为可读、可写和可执行,组权限和其他用户权限设置为只读:
    chmod u+rwx,g+r,o+r test.txt

    以下是一些常用的选项:
    – -R:递归地修改目录及其子目录的权限;
    – -v:显示每个文件或目录的权限修改过程。

    例如,以下命令将目录dir1及其子目录下的所有文件的所有者权限设置为可读、可写和可执行:
    chmod -R u+rwx dir1

    需要注意的是,只有文件的所有者或管理员有权限更改文件的权限。同时,不当地修改文件权限可能会导致系统安全性问题,因此要谨慎使用”chmod”命令。

    以上就是Linux进入权限的命令”chmod”的使用方法和注意事项。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,有几种常用的命令可以用于更改或管理文件的访问权限。下面是五个常见的命令来控制Linux文件的进入权限:

    1. chmod:这是最常用的命令之一,用于更改文件或目录的权限。它允许用户设定所有者、所属组和其他用户的读取、写入和执行权限。例如,要将文件的所有者设置为可读写,所属组和其他用户只读的权限,可以使用以下命令:
    “`
    chmod u=rw,g=r,o=r filename
    “`

    2. chown:这个命令用于更改文件或目录的所有者。它可以将文件的所有者更改为其他用户或组。例如,要将文件的所有者更改为”john”,可以使用以下命令:
    “`
    chown john filename
    “`

    3. chgrp:这个命令用于更改文件或目录的所属组。它可以将文件的所属组更改为其他组。例如,要将文件的所属组更改为”admins”,可以使用以下命令:
    “`
    chgrp admins filename
    “`

    4. ls:这个命令用于列出文件或目录的详细信息,包括文件的权限。使用`ls -l`可以列出文件的权限、所有者、所属组等信息。例如,以下是使用`ls -l`列出文件的示例:
    “`
    -rw-r–r– 1 john users 4096 Feb 1 10:00 filename
    “`

    5. umask:这个命令用于设置新创建文件的默认权限。umask命令设置了默认情况下不设置的权限位(与chmod相反)。
    “`
    umask 022
    “`

    以上是控制Linux文件进入权限的常用命令。使用这些命令,用户可以更改文件和目录的权限、所有者和所属组,以满足安全和访问控制需求。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ux中,有几种不同的方法可以进入权限。

    1. 使用su命令:
    su(Switch User)命令可以切换用户。默认情况下,如果不指定切换到的用户,su命令会切换到超级用户(root)。
    “`bash
    su
    “`
    在执行此命令后,系统将提示您输入目标用户的密码。如果输入正确,您将进入目标用户的权限。

    2. 使用sudo命令:
    sudo(Superuser Do)命令允许普通用户以root用户的身份运行特定的命令。要使用sudo命令,您需要为当前用户添加sudo权限。
    “`bash
    sudo su
    “`
    执行此命令后,系统将提示您输入当前用户的密码,然后您将进入root权限。

    3. 使用ssh命令:
    如果您在远程连接到Linux服务器上,可以使用ssh(Secure Shell)命令进入权限。
    “`bash
    ssh <用户名>@<服务器IP地址>
    “`
    执行此命令后,系统将提示您输入目标用户的密码。如果输入正确,您将远程登录到目标服务器,并进入目标用户的权限。

    4. 使用su -命令:
    su -命令是su命令的一个变体,它会在切换用户时同时切换到目标用户的环境变量。这对于需要使用目标用户的环境变量的操作很有用。
    “`bash
    su – <目标用户名>
    “`
    在执行此命令后,系统将提示您输入目标用户的密码。如果输入正确,您将进入目标用户的权限,并且继承其环境变量。

    5. 使用登录管理界面:
    如果您使用的是图形化界面的Linux发行版(如Ubuntu、Fedora等),您可以通过登录管理界面进行用户切换。在登录界面中,您可以选择要登录的用户,并输入相应的密码,然后进入相应用户的权限。

    这些是在Linux中进入权限的一些常用方法。您可以根据自己的需求选择最适合的方法来进入权限。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部